S/O @MissInfo for letting me know this was around, I should have known, I was slewing, Cause ALL Marvel Movies is MY ISH!!! This Trailer goes way past Expectations, I need a Time Machine to go to May 4th When it drops!!! Hit the Jump to see for yourself!!!
